- 1. Read the relevant parts of ArchitectureInternals
+ 1. Read the relevant parts of ArchitectureInternals; watching http://www.channels.com/episodes/show/11765800/Getting-to-know-the-Cassandra-Codebase will probably also be useful
1. Check if someone else has already begun work on the change you have in mind in the [[https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/CASSANDRA|issue tracker]]
1. If not, create a ticket describing the change you're proposing in the issue tracker
1. Check out the latest version of the source code

* Verify that you follow Cassandra's CodeStyle.
* Verify that your change works by adding a unit test.
* Make sure all tests pass by running "ant test" in the project directory.
+ * For testing multi-node behavior, https://github.com/pcmanus/ccm is useful
1. When you're happy with the result create a patch:
* svn add <any new file>
* svn diff > branchname-issue.txt (e.g. trunk-123.txt, cassandra-0.6-123.txt)
